Young Women Camp is an outdoor experience for young women ages 12 to 18. It gives young women opportunities to:
    LDS Camp Help
  • Draw closer to Heavenly Father and His Son, Jesus Christ
  • Feel the influence of the Spirit.
  • Serve others.
  • Build friendships and unity
  • Learn skills.
  • Appreciate God's creations.
  • Have fun!
